Fun Activities to Bond with Your Orange Tabby Cat
Engaging in fun activities together is a great way to strengthen the bond with your cute orange tabby cat. One popular and effective method is interactive play. Cats, especially tabbies, are natural hunters and will enjoy toys that mimic prey, such as feather teasers or small stuffed animals. Set aside dedicated playtime each day to encourage physical activity and mental stimulation. You can also try puzzle feeders, which not only entertain your cat but also encourage them to use their natural instincts to problem-solve.
Beyond interactive play, creating a cozy environment is another way to bond with your orange tabby. Cats love napping in warm spots, so providing a soft blanket or a sunlit perch can make for a contented companion. Regular brushing sessions are not just good for their coat; they also serve as a bonding experience. Your cat will appreciate the extra attention, and it’s a great way to keep them healthy by removing loose fur. Lastly, remember that cats love attention, so simply spending quality time with your orange tabby, cuddling, or even talking to them, can strengthen the bond between you both.
